L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 906|回复: 1

我书本一实验有点小想法!

[复制链接]
发表于 2005-3-31 22:58:28 | 显示全部楼层 |阅读模式
实验这样:在用户主目录创建.xsession文件,加入
#!/bin/sh
xterm &
exec metacity
然后在控制台登陆,startx后,问看到了啥东西,为啥会看到这些东西

小弟以为啥也看不到,应为我觉得.xsession是用显示管理器登陆时会去查找的文件,用于起client,startx不会找它,不知道是否如此?
发表于 2005-4-1 09:15:55 | 显示全部楼层
请你仔细看,原文如下:

步骤一: 了解X的启动顺序
1. 创建并编辑/etc/X11/xinit/xinitrc.d/xeyes,加入以下行并设为可执行
#!/bin/sh
xeyes &
2. 切换到runlevel5
3. 使用显示管理器登录系统 gdm,kdm,xdm等.发生了什么?切换到虚拟控制台,运行
startx --:1
发生了什么? 为什么需要指定 -- :1?
4. 在创建的用户主目录下创建并编辑.xsession文件,增加以下行并设为可执行:
#!/bin/sh
xterm &
exec metacity
5. 使用这个帐户登录,发生什么? 使用这个帐户在虚拟控制台登录,并运行startx,发生了什么?


并不是你所说的“然后在控制台登陆,startx后,问看到了啥东西,为啥会看到这些东西”

本来startx 就不会去执行$HOME/.xsession ! 这里只是让你比较xdm和startx启动X的不同!
拜托认真一点!
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表